The V15 series AC Mode 3 controller is a single/three-phase compatible intelligent charging device built to European standard EN 61851. With a maximum output power of 22kW, it combines low-power adaptability and high-power charging capacity, designed for residential, commercial, and public charging scenarios across Europe. Integrating multi-mode networking, dynamic load balancing and multi-level security protection, it delivers efficient, flexible charging management solutions for industrial clients and commercial procurement projects.

Core Features of the V15 Three-phase AC Mode 3 Controller

Full-scenario Power Adaptation

The V15 series supports stepless power adjustment from single-phase 7kW to three-phase 22kW, compatible with mainstream electric vehicle models in the European market. Its intelligent derating function enables stable operation at a minimum current of 6A, suitable for deployment in areas with aging power grids without extra circuit expansion. This feature cuts upfront construction costs for commercial users and shortens project implementation cycles.

Multi-layer Safety Protection System

The controller adopts a dual protection mechanism with A+6 level leakage protection and electronic lock linkage control, compliant with IEC 62196-2. It integrates multiple fault diagnosis functions, covering overvoltage, undervoltage, overcurrent, overtemperature protection, plus relay adhesion, leakage, grounding and CP abnormality detection. It supports TLS encrypted data transmission and aligns with GDPR user privacy specifications, ensuring data security for commercial operation scenarios.

Diverse Charging & Interaction Modes

The device supports multiple charging modes to fit different operation demands: plug-and-charge, RFID card authentication, scheduled charging and offline billing. It comes with standard LED display, with LCD display available as an optional configuration. Orderly charging and RFID swipe start functions are also optional, allowing users to match configurations to specific project requirements.

Flexible Networking & Operation Management

The controller supports three network access methods — 4G, WiFi and Ethernet — to adapt to different site network conditions. For networked deployments, it supports cloud billing via card swiping or QR code scanning, smart home charging linkage, and remote start/stop via mobile app. For commercial sites, the load balancing function optimizes pile group power distribution during peak hours, improving equipment utilization and operational revenue.

Application Scenarios for the V15 Three-phase AC Charging Controller

Residential Garages & Private Charging

For private residential garages, the V15 controller supports Graffiti WiFi remote control and scheduled charging. It can be linked with on-site photovoltaic systems to charge vehicles during peak photovoltaic generation periods, helping users cut electricity costs. Its wide operating temperature range and outdoor-rated design support stable installation in both indoor garages and outdoor parking areas.

Commercial Buildings & Workplace Charging

For commercial buildings, office parks and retail properties, the controller supports Ethernet-based group control management and time-sharing billing, and can integrate with third-party payment systems. This allows property managers to run unified charging operation management and set flexible pricing strategies. Its intelligent derating function also reduces power grid transformation costs for existing buildings.

Public Charging Stations

For public charging stations and roadside charging facilities, 4G networking and dynamic load balancing help operators optimize pile group power distribution during peak hours, lifting equipment utilization and overall station revenue. The multi-layer fault detection mechanism reduces on-site maintenance frequency, and the remote O&M platform supports remote upgrades and restarts, lowering daily operation costs.

FAQ About the V15 European Standard Mode 3 Charging Controller

What is the difference between AC and DC charging controllers for commercial deployment?

The selection depends on the actual positioning of the charging station. For residential areas, hotels and mixed-use properties, AC charging controllers are a practical choice, as they require no additional power modules and involve lower station construction costs. For highway service areas or sites serving heavy-duty vehicles, DC charging solutions are more applicable. Our team can provide targeted suggestions based on your specific project needs.

What regional standards does this V15 charging controller meet?

The V15 series AC Mode 3 controller is designed in compliance with European standard EN 61851, with its electronic lock and connector design conforming to IEC 62196-2. Its data transmission and user data processing comply with GDPR privacy specifications, making it suitable for commercial operation projects across European regions.
